Story:The storyline of E.V.O.: Search for Eden follows the same patterns as modern Evolution theories. The players first controls a prehistoric sea organism, and fights to gain evolution points with which he can improve his fish's body parts and upgrade his attack/defense abilities. The gameplay is not completely linear, which means that certain choices of paths and stages will affect the player's success. The game is composed of a series of stages, in which the sea organism slowly evolves into an amphibian, and later a land-only creature. The physical changes are fairly scientifically accurate which gives the game a semi-educational purpose as well.Show more

I like to describe it as Darwinist propaganda because its a funny thing to say and honestly its an awesome premise. It is your job to evolve through the various ages of life on earth. Become the strongest fish! Then, walk onto land and become the strongest Amphibian! Then become a Dinosaur and be forced to survive as a mammal during the ice age. Can you discover the key to evolve into a primate and use tools? Such an excellent game!
This is a really cool idea for a game where you go through stages of evolution and try to fix evolution gone wrong. Wanna be the ultimate amphibian? You can! Wanna be the last dinosaur in the mammal age? Reign supreme over the new mammals! It really should be brought back so more people can play this game.

Crimson AllianceCrimson Alliance is a co-op action role-playing game developed by Certain Affinity and published by Microsoft Studios. The game was first announced at RTX 2011 and was available for demo at E3, ComicCon and PAX Prime,[2] with the press release being announced on May 31, 2011.[3] Crimson Alliance was released on September 7, 2011 on Xbox LIVE Arcade for free as a freemium. Player can choose to pay between 800 Microsoft Points for one character class or 1200 Microsoft Points for all three character classes.[4] The game was also offered as a free bonus code download for those who purchased all five of the fourth annual Xbox Live Summer of Arcade titles before August 23, 2011.[5]

Kamen Rider Club: Gekitotsu Shocker LandKamen Rider Club: Gekitotsu Shocker Land is an action adventure game developed for the Famicom and published by Bandai in Japan on February 3, 1988. It is based on Bandai's Kamen Rider franchise, a weekly science fiction story created by Japanese manga artist Shotaro Ishinomori which was published in Shōnen Magazine, as well as being aired on television.

This first chapter of Shenmue kicks off Yu Suzuki's cinematic Dreamcast tour-de-force, an exploration-heavy adventure that has players immerse themselves in Yokosuka, Japan. Players slip into the role of a young martial artist named Ryo Hazuki, who is on the trail of his father's killer. On the way, players must talk with hundreds of characters, engage in martial arts battles, and marvel at the realistic depiction of the Japanese coastal town.
